Rosegarden
Rosegarden is a long-standing Linux-based DAW that excels in MIDI sequencing and musical notation. It is designed for composers who need to write scores and sequence MIDI parts simultaneously. While it is not the best tool for modern audio recording or mixing, it is a powerful companion for classical composition and MIDI-heavy projects. Quartz Composer
Quartz Composer is a legacy visual programming environment for macOS that was once used by designers to create advanced animations and interactive prototypes. It is now largely obsolete and has been superseded by modern tools like Origami Studio and ProtoPie.
